Output 21aabd2c574b39fb943efd9fe1905be1aaa7c0c5194777712599369ce018905f:25

value
1221414
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 52c8b7685805c5586e884882d7f724dea18e7b27 OP_EQUALVERIFY OP_CHECKSIG
address
18Yirkeas3Fkd9NnAQj9iVtRgPUesiXnT5
transaction
21aabd2c574b39fb943efd9fe1905be1aaa7c0c5194777712599369ce018905f
spent
true